Tissue repair primarily occurs through regeneration and fibrosis. Regeneration involves the replacement of damaged cells with new, functional cells of the same type, restoring normal tissue architecture and function. In contrast, fibrosis occurs when the tissue is unable to regenerate fully, leading to the formation of scar tissue composed of collagen that may not fully restore the original functionality. Both processes are essential for healing but can vary depending on the type and extent of injury.

The two types of human tissue that do not undergo mitosis are nervous tissue and cardiac muscle tissue. Neurons, the primary cells in nervous tissue, typically do not divide after reaching maturity, which limits their ability to regenerate. Similarly, cardiac muscle cells, or cardiomyocytes, have a very limited capacity for division and repair, making heart tissue less regenerative after injury compared to other tissues.
